Bio

Prior to joining Inco Capital, Charles co-managed Lebanon’s first technology venture capital fund (incubated by Microsoft, Intel, Cisco and HP). In 2004, Charles co-founded Nomad Capital, a boutique investment bank focused on opportunities in North Africa. Nomad Capital incubated several new businesses (telecom, outsourcing, retail) and continues to manage a thriving corporate finance business. Charles continues to sit on the company’s board. Prior to Nomad Capital, Charles worked for a major family office where he managed a substantial hedge fund portfolio, evaluated private equity investments and worked on major real estate projects. Prior to that, Charles joined IPD, a leading think-tank based in New York City, created and led by Joseph Stiglitz, 2001 Nobel laureate in Economics. Charles worked on economic and policy issues in Nigeria, Liberia and Tanzania. In 1998 and based in New York City, Charles joined a team of four investment professionals solely focused on analyzing hedge funds on behalf of a consortium of France’s largest banks led by Credit Agricole Indosuez. The team was also responsible for supervising Credit Agricole Indosuez’s hedge fund investments. Prior to that, Charles spent a year as a financial consultant for Merrill Lynch Asset Management (Middle East). Charles also serves as Director of La Revue Phenicienne, Lebanon's oldest publishing house. He is also listed in Marquis’ Who’s Who in the World database and is a recipient of the International President's Award for Iconic Achievement in Business from the International Biographical Centre of Cambrige in the UK. Charles holds a BA in Management and an MS in Finance from Dauphine University in Paris as well as an MBA in Management and Finance from Columbia Business School in New York City.

Les Editions de La Revue Phenicienne

Les Editions de La Revue Phenicienne is the Corm family's business publishing house and the oldest publishing outfit in Lebanon. It was created in 1920 by the late Charles Corm and has re-emerged as a major player in the Middle East publishing sector.
